A Brunello di Montalcino born from twenty years of research on sangiovese, thus representing the best synthesis of territory, selection and technological innovation.

Complex but immediately captivating, with a muscular and toned body, amazing in power and softness, Castello Banfi's Brunello di Montalcino DOCG Poggio alle Mura is characterized by a sweet and gentle tannic texture. A great classic.

Tasting Notes.: the color is deep red. The complexity of aromas reveals notes of blackberry jam, tobacco and vanilla. In the mouth there is an immediate sense of great structure, soft and very balanced. The mouth finish is soft and persistent. For great aging.

Pairings: throughout the meal, it is an ideal accompaniment to red meats, savory game and aged cheeses.

Name Banfi Brunello di Montalcino Poggio alle Mura 2008
Type Red wine green still
Classification DOCG Brunello di Montalcino
Year 2008
Format 0.75 l Standard x 6 bottles with original wooden case original
Grade alcohol 15.00% by volume
Grape varieties 100% Sangiovese
Country
Italy
Region Tuscany
Location Specialized vineyards located around the Castello di Poggio alle Mura (SI)
Climate Altitude: meters 210-220 a.s.l. Layout: hillside.
Soil composition. Yellowish brown color; sandy loam texture, coarse loam; limestone; substrate of sandy sediments of marine origin with Pliocene conglomeratic levels; abundant rounded skeleton.
Farming system. Spurred cordon
No. of plants per hectare 4,200 vines/ha
Yield per hectare 60 q.li/ha
Fermentation temperature 27-29 °C
Vinification The grape harvest is followed by. alcoholic fermentation e maceration of 12-13 days in combined steel and Horizon wood vats at controlled temperature (27-29°C).
Aging Matured for 2 years for 90% in barrique of French oak - made according to company production specifications - and the remaining 10% in Slavonian oak barrels, before release to the market the wine is aged in bottles for another 12 months.
Allergens Contains sulfites
Matching Ideal accompaniment to savory red meats and game, aged cheeses and as a meditation wine.
